Chain link fence installation involves setting up durable, metal fencing that provides a secure boundary around residential, commercial, or industrial properties. This service typically includes measuring the area, preparing the ground, installing posts, and attaching the chain link mesh to create a continuous barrier. Local contractors may also offer additional features such as gates or privacy slats to customize the fence to specific needs. The process is designed to produce a sturdy, long-lasting enclosure that can withstand various weather conditions and daily use.

The overview below groups typical Chain Link Fence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Newton County, MO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or chain link fence repairs, such as replacing a few panels or fixing sections,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and fence size.
Basic Fence Installation - Installing a new chain link fence for a standard yard usually costs between $1,500 and $3,000. Most projects of this type are completed within this range, with fewer exceeding $4,000 for larger or more complex setups.
Full Fence Replacement - Replacing an entire existing chain link fence typically costs from $3,000 to $7,000, depending on the length and height of the fence. Larger, more intricate projects can reach $8,000 or more, but most fall within this range.
Custom or Commercial Projects - Larger, custom-designed chain link fences for commercial or industrial properties can start around $10,000 and may go well above $20,000. These projects are less common and tend to be at the higher end of the cost spectrum due to specialized requ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of installing a chain link fence? Chain link fences provide durable, low-maintenance security and define property boundaries effectively for residential and commercial properties in Newton County, MO.
What types of properties are suitable for chain link fence installation? Chain link fences are versatile and can be installed around residential yards, commercial lots, sports fields, and industrial sites in the local area.
What should I consider when choosing a chain link fence contractor? It's important to select experienced local contractors who understand the area's regulations and can recommend appropriate fencing solutions for your property.
Are there different styles or heights available for chain link fences? Yes, local service providers offer various heights, gauges, and finishes to meet specific security, privacy, or aesthetic needs.
What maintenance is required for a chain link fence? Chain link fences generally require minimal upkeep, mainly occasional cleaning and minor repairs to keep them in good condition over time.
